Life Drawing by Robin Black (received through NetGalley)
5 stars
 


This is an astoundingly good book.  One that makes me fall in love with reading all over again.  Augusta (Gus) and Owen are a middle aged couple who move into a country farmhouse in order to start their relationship anew after a few tumultuous years.  Their isolation ends when Allison moves next door and the fragile and claustrophobic relationships begin to unravel in surprising ways.  I really enjoyed the graceful language of the novel and the insight into these character’s lives.  It is definitely one of the best books that I have read so far this year.  I received this book from NetGalley in exchange for an honest review. 
 

The Art of Arranging Flowers by Lynne Branard (received through NetGalley)
4 stars
 


I did not quite expect to like this book as much as I did.  It follows Ruby, small-town florist, as she deals with a sad childhood and the recent death of her beloved sister.  She is a compelling and believable character and she demonstrates so much love for her community while walling off her own heart.  This book is mostly about her friendships and how with their help she begins to let people into her life.  At times, it skips over seemingly big events but I actually really liked how that was done as it focused on the day to day events that make life fulfilling.  I am not sure if I would have picked up this book if I hadn’t received it from NetGalley so I am very glad of this reading opportunity.
